1.Progress of Bevacizumab in Malignant Pleural Effusion Caused by Non-small Cell Lung Cancer.
Chinese Journal of Lung Cancer 2019;22(2):118-124
Lung cancer is the most commonly diagnosed cancer worldwide. Malignant pleural effusion (MPE) caused by advanced lung cancer seriously affect the patients' quality of life and prognosis. The management of MPE includes thoracentesis, pleurodesis, indwelling pleural catheters and drug perfusion in pleural cavity. Vascular endothelial growth factor (VEGF) and its receptor are a group of important ligands and receptors that affect angiogenesis. They are the main factors controlling angiogenesis, and they play an important role in the formation of MPE. Bevacizumab is a recombinant humanized VEGF monoclonal antibody, competitively binding to endogenous VEGF receptor. Bevacizumab can inhibit new blood vessel formation, reduce vascular permeability, prevent pleural effusion accumulation and slow the growth of cancers. This review aims to discuss the progress of bevacizumab in the treatment of MPE caused by non-small cell lung cancer (NSCLC), and explore the clinical application, efficacy, safety and future direction of bevacizumab.

2.Pancreatitis from Metastatic Small Cell Lung Cancer: Successful Treatment with Endoscopic Intrapancreatic Stenting.
Jong Shin WOO ; Kwang Ro JOO ; Yong Sik WOO ; Jae Young JANG ; Young Woon CHANG ; Joung Il LEE ; Rin CHANG
The Korean Journal of Internal Medicine 2006;21(4):256-261
Lung cancer metastases can occur in almost any organ. However, metastasis of small cell lung cancer to the pancreas is rare. Moreover, not all cases present with clinically diagnosed pancreatitis. We recently treated a patient with small cell lung carcinoma that invaded the pancreatic duct causing acute pancreatitis. Generally, the treatment for tumor-induced acute pancreatitis is initially supportive followed by aggressive chemotherapy or surgery. If the patient can tolerate the insertion of an endoscopic intrapancreatic stent, this is performed in addition to chemotherapy and surgery; this approach offers a safe and effective treatment modality for such patients.
